(July 7, 2010) The New College Alumnae/i Association (NCAA) welcomed its fourth alum coordinator, Morgan Boecher ’06, to the Association staff on June 7, 2010.

Morgan graduated from New College in May of 2010 with a BA in Anthropology / Gender Studies. He traveled to Japan in the summer of 2009 to interview tea ceremony practitioners for his thesis, Traditional Place and Feminist Space: The Japanese Tea Ceremony Makes Room for Empowerment. He also spent a semester abroad in Paris, France during the spring of 2008 to study French language and culture.

In addition to being an avid traveler, Morgan is an active leader, having participated as orientation leader for three years in a row as well as having revitalized the feminist and LGBTQ groups on campus. Through these groups, Morgan has organized numerous events, including Sexual Assault Awareness Week, The Clothesline Project, Love Your Body Week and Queery Week. Additionally, he arranged for the performance group Sex Signals and alum Suzanne Clayton to come to New College and further educate on diversity issues.

Morgan continues his activism as a volunteer blog editor for Paradigm Shift, a feminist organization based in New York City. He is a transsexual man and goes by masculine pronouns.

“NCAA is pleased to have Morgan on board continuing the tradition of stellar alum coordinators that have come before him,” stated VP of Alumnae/i Affairs Jessica Rogers.  “Morgan brings a set of skills to his job that will prove to be invaluable during his time here.”

The alum coordinator position was established in May of 2007 by the NCAA as an opportunity for a recent New College graduate to learn and develop skills that will benefit his or her future career and life passions. During their tenure, alum coordinators serve as ambassadors and liaisons between students and young alums and the Association.
